Key performance areas
Assist with preventive maintenance and repairs. Maintain machinery and mechanical equipment to include, but not limited to, engines, motors, pneumatic tools, and production equipment according to diagrams, sketches, operating manuals, manufacturer’s specifications, and environmental health and safety guidelines. Interpret hydraulic and electrical schematics.
Additionally, the Maintenance Technician is responsible to:
Clear clogged drains and replace fixtures.
Assist in maintaining and replacing defective parts using hand tools, power tools, precision measuring instruments, hoists, and cranes.
Support the adjustment of functional parts, devices, and control instruments using hand tools, levels, plumb bobs, and straightedges.
Clean and lubricate machine parts such as shafts, pulleys, gears, and bearings using rags, brushes, grease guns, and oil.
Replace machine belts.
Assist with preventive maintenance on equipment listed in PM Pro and address repairs requested in the maintenance log.
Perform other related duties as assigned.
